Global K-pop superstar Jennie of BLACKPINK is set to appear as a guest on the fourth season of hit Korean dating reality show “EXchange” (also known as “Transit Love”), adding new momentum to a series that has been dominating local streaming charts. The show’s production team confirmed her appearance on Nov. 26, though they declined to disclose filming details.
A spokesperson for the Tving original series said, “It is true that Jennie will join as a guest,” but added, “We ask for your understanding that we cannot confirm the specific filming schedule.” The platform has invited guest stars each episode to boost entertainment value, with previous appearances by Dawn, Roy Kim and Lee Minhyuk of BTOB.
Format built on emotional tension leads to explosive viewership
“EXchange” follows former couples who move into the same house to revisit past relationships, confront unresolved emotions and explore new romantic possibilities. The mix of real-time emotion, jealousy and self-reflection has made the show one of Korea’s most talked-about in the reality show genre.
Since its premiere, the fourth season has exceeded expectations. The show ranked No. 1 among all new paid subscribers on Tving immediately after release and continues to hold the top spot on the platform. In the first 10 days alone, its paid subscriber contribution jumped 530 percent compared to Season 1, 149 percent compared to Season 2 and 74 percent compared to Season 3 — a rare growth curve even among established reality franchises.
The strong momentum has continued, with the series remaining at No. 1 in weekly paid subscriber contribution for seven consecutive weeks.
